No 9
Date of Notice 22 August 1889
  Groom Bride
Names of Parties Thomas Kilborn Harreld Annie Elizabeth Buckthought
BDM Match (93%) Thomas Kilbom Harrold Annie Elizabeth Buckthought
  ๐Ÿ’ 1889/1954
Condition Bachelor Spinster
Profession Sealer
Age 34 29
Dwelling Place Eltham Eltham
Length of Residence 7 years 6 years
Marriage Place Church of England at Waimate
Folio 89/2011
Consent
Date of Certificate 2 September 1889
Officiating Minister Revd W. H. Kay, Ch. of England

No 10
Date of Notice 25 September 1889
  Groom Bride
Names of Parties Charles Lewis Duggan Elizabeth Ann Crosby
  ๐Ÿ’ 1889/2024
Condition Bachelor Spinster
Profession Farmer
Age 19 16
Dwelling Place Midhirst Midhirst
Length of Residence 3 years 9 years at Midhirst
Marriage Place In the dwelling house of Henry Grooby
Folio 89/2006
Consent Charles Duggan father, Henry Grooby Father
Date of Certificate 25 September 1889
Officiating Minister Revd J. L. Linford, Wesleyan
